Codea 4+

Creative coding

Two Lives Left

Conçu pour iPad

    • 4,8 • 19 notes
    • 17,99 €

Captures d’écran

Description

"C'est un peu le Garage Band de la programmation." – Wired

"[Codea] pour iPad est une manière brillante d'écrire et exécuter des logiciels sur votre iPad." – Gizmodo

Codea vous permet de créer des jeux et des simulations — ou presque toute idée visuelle que vous voulez. Concrétisez vos idées en créations interactives en vous servant des fonctionnalités comme le multi-tactile et l'accéléromètre de l'iPad.

Nous pensons que Codea est le plus bel éditeur de code que vous utiliserez, et il est simple. Codea est conçu pour que vous puissiez toucher votre code. Vous voulez modifier un nombre ? Touchez le et glissez, tout simplement. Et pour une couleur, ou une image ? Le toucher ouvrira des éditeurs visuels vous permettant de choisir exactement ce que vous voulez.

Codea est construit autour du langage de programmation Lua. Lua est un langage simple et élégant qui ne s'appuie que très peu sur des symboles — un match parfait pour l'iPad.

Voici comment l'utiliser : tapez votre code. Appuyez sur lecture pour voir le résultat. Interagissez avec. Soyez créatif.

VIDEO

Voir twolivesleft.com/Codea

FONCTIONALITÉS

• Le moteur de rendu des graphiques vectorielles et images plurifonctionnel vous permet de prototyper ce que vous pouvez imaginer.
• Plusieurs projets exemple pour initier l'apprentissage et inspirer vos créations, y compris les simulations et les jeux.
• Générer des effets sonores aléatoires rétro-jeu que vous pouvez intégrer dans vos créations.
• Touchez votre code : Appuyez sur les chiffres, les couleurs et les images pour les modifier.
• Documentation de référence en ligne complète, accessible à partir du clavier.
• Autocomplétion intelligente suggère des mots-clés et fonctions.
• Importer vos propres ressources de Dropbox, photos et bien plus.
• Un moteur physique complet pour simuler les motions complexes.
• Ajouter des paramètres à votre interface de simulation ou de jeu, et vous pouvez modifier les variables pendant l'exécution.
• Interagir avec l'accéléromètre et le Multi-Touch de votre appareil.
• Enregistrement vidéo : enregistrer des vidéos de vos projets et à les partager !
• Codea rend votre code avec la belle coloration syntaxique.
• Codea peut rendre des graphiques 3D.
• Intégration d'une capacité de Shader GLSL avec un éditeur intégré shader.

INFORMATIONS IMPORTANTES

• Si vous avez besoin d'aide ou souhaitez nous contacter, merci d'utiliser le lien de support sur cette page

Nouveautés

Version 3.10

Air Code
Correction du problème de désynchronisation entre Codea et Air Code
Les ressources sont désormais disponibles dans un dossier Ressources
Capacité de lire, sauvegarder, copier et renommer des fichiers binaires depuis VSCode
Possibilité de modifier les valeurs des variables et des surveillances pendant le débogage
Mieux exposer certains types personnalisés dans le débogueur de VSCode (tableaux, couleurs, etc.)
Correction du verrouillage logiciel lors de l'enregistrement d'un fichier alors que le débogueur est en pause
Correction des points d'arrêt ne fonctionnant pas dans les fichiers nouvellement créés

Clés de Ressource
Correction des problèmes d'utilisation des ressources externes
Amélioration du support des Clés de Ressource dans le rendu Moderne (pour correspondre à l'Ancien)

Sélecteur de Ressource
Correction du problème où toutes les sections seraient affichées pour les sous-dossiers
Permet de choisir des ressources provenant d'autres projets
Ajout du support du sélecteur pour require()
Rafraîchit l'interface utilisateur de l'outil Générateur de Son dans le sélecteur de son()

Require
Charge les fichiers dans l'ordre du tampon lors de l'importation d'un projet avec require()

Rendu Moderne
Correction du problème où lire la composante rouge d'une couleur la retournerait comme un flottant

Rendu Ancien
spriteSize retourne maintenant correctement le nombre de pages des PDFs
Ajoute les formats de fichiers sonores et musicaux pris en charge à la documentation
readImage retourne nil lorsque la page demandée est hors limites

ObjC
Suppression des énumérations et valeurs dépréciées
Ajout d'énumérations non nommées sous objc.enum
Ajout de objc.async pour exécuter du code de manière asynchrone sur le fil principal

Notes et avis

4,8 sur 5
19 notes

19 notes

lostania ,

Une merveille

Un travail de fou pour un résultat éblouissant. Un énorme bravo aux développeurs qui ont été parmi les premiers à comprendre où était l'avenir de la programmation sur tablettes. Merci à eux.

JanOllis ,

Enfin une solution de codage sur ipad

Une solution pour expérimenter/développer nos propres jeux dans un environnement ios.
Bel trouvaille... et tout ça en LUA : un des language les plus adaptés à la programmation de jeux.
Simple et efficace, même pour les débutants.
Un grand bravo

Élias de Kelliwic’h ,

It could be great if it worked with Blender

I would love an app like Shade which would allow you to export your shaders to blender. Would allow me to toy around when I am away from my computer to make progress around shaders and then reuse them easily in Blender

Confidentialité de l’app

Le développeur Two Lives Left a indiqué que le traitement des données tel que décrit ci‑dessous pouvait figurer parmi les pratiques de l’app en matière de confidentialité. Pour en savoir plus, consultez la politique de confidentialité du développeur.

Données non collectées

Le développeur ne collecte aucune donnée avec cette app.

Les pratiques en matière de confidentialité peuvent varier, notamment en fonction des fonctionnalités que vous utilisez ou de votre âge. En savoir plus

Prend en charge

  • Game Center

    Défiez vos amis et consultez les classements et réalisations.

  • Partage familial

    Jusqu’à six membres de la famille peuvent utiliser cette app lorsque le partage familial est activé.

Du même développeur

Vous aimerez peut-être aussi

LuaStudio
Productivité
GoCoEdit - Code & Text Editor
Productivité
Pythonista 3
Productivité
Grafio 4 - Diagram Maker
Productivité
iCircuit
Productivité
iWriter Pro
Productivité